No Comparison
By: J. B. Hixson, Ph.D.
February 3, 2010

What is more, I consider everything a loss compared to the surpassing greatness of knowing Christ Jesus my Lord, for whose sake I have lost all things. I consider them rubbish that I may gain Christ. (Philippians 3:8, NIV) 

Logos Bible Software recently came out with a major new release, Logos 4.0.  Actually, it is a complete rewrite of Logos 3.0.  I have used Logos for over ten years as an indispensable tool in my ministry, as well as my personal Bible study, so I upgraded the very day 4.0 came out.  I was eager to see what changes had been made.  The pre-release hype had filled me with high expectations.

Logos did not disappoint me.  After installing 4.0, I opened my old 3.0 version on one screen and the new 4.0 version on another so that I could take note of the improvements.  I was amazed!  I found myself whistling the tune to the old Sesame Street song, One of These Things Is Not Like the Other.  Truly, the new technology and functionality of 4.0 made 3.0 look like child's play.  In fact, by comparison, there really is no comparison.

What a blessing to live in this age of advanced digital technology.  It seems like just yesterday I was singing along to my Dad's old reel-to-reel tapes in the living room of our saltbox house in Connecticut.  I was quite the karaoke star long before karaoke became the rage.  I'm too embarrassed to reveal whose music was on that old reel-to-reel tape, but I'll give you a hint: His last name is Manilow and his first name starts with a "B" and ends with an "arry."  Have you listened to a reel-to-reel tape lately?  Or even a cassette tape?  What a difference!  By comparison with today's digital MP3s, there really is no comparison.

Speaking of comparisons...I do a hefty amount of flying in my ministry and occasionally get upgraded to First Class because of my Continental Elite status.  Such was the case recently.  For the first time in quite a while I found myself enjoying some of the finer luxuries in life, like elbow room and a meal that you don't have to eat with your fingers.  It was wonderful.  As my mind wandered to the less fortunate souls in coach, I thought: Ahhh!  By comparison, there really is no comparison.

But there is one comparison that transcends all others.  It is the comparison between life with Christ and life without Christ.  Without Christ, even the most enjoyable moments are devoid of meaning.  Without Christ, all the riches in the world can't buy everlasting hope.  Without Christ, pain and suffering have no resolution.  Without Christ, relationships are superficial and fleeting.  Without Christ, every victory is hollow and short-lived.  Without Christ, the future is uncertain.  Without Christ, all is vanity.

Everything pales in comparison to the greatness of knowing Jesus Christ, God's Son and our Savior.  With Christ, we can rejoice no matter what the circumstance.  With Christ, we can see the unseen.  With Christ, we can walk through the valley.  With Christ, even the worst of times fade beneath the glory of knowing Him.  With Christ, all things are possible.
